> Each UIMA AS deployment descriptor requires at least one Broker URL for the 
> connection factory. Instead of hard coding the URL, perhaps a placeholder for 
> it should be used. At runtime, the placeholder could be resolved to the 
> actual URL by Spring resolver component. The value could come from either an 
> external file or from an environment. The new approach should accommodate 
> specifying more than one placeholder, since an aggregate may have delegates 
> whose queues are managed by a different broker. The new approach would 
> simplify deployment of UIMA AS services, especially during testing.
> A placeholder syntax could be inherited from Spring, where it looks like 
> ${placeholder-name}. 
> dd2spring would need to change to handle a placeholder notation in addition 
> to supporting hard coded broker URL that we use now. A new bean must be added 
> to the generated xml. It will be :
> <bean 
> class="org.springframework.beans.factory.config.PropertyPlaceholderConfigurer">
>     <property name="systemPropertiesModeName"  
> value="SYSTEM_PROPERTIES_MODE_OVERRIDE"/>
>    </bean>
>  
> This bean is setup to resolve placeholders using system variables, like 
> -Dplaceholder-name=placeholder-value
